Output ecfd93392362a5eef40591051e20009041f54677f3693ddc235926af82a6db77:25

value
562842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5033634cef3f0feed5c88f1c41784ab856295e73 OP_EQUAL
address
3915YPCZupC2XtLno5dzVLD6z5cJ4at8XJ
transaction
ecfd93392362a5eef40591051e20009041f54677f3693ddc235926af82a6db77
spent
true